Hey, welcome aboard! The seat-map renderer for the Gildmoor Playhouse pulls layouts from our Rowcall service. If seats show up blank, restart the renderer pod first — that fixes it nine times out of ten. To query Rowcall directly for debugging, you'll need to authenticate with the key below.

app token of badug-tahaf = qvz11-nP5FBNr8qnh

Runbook: TelemPress compression sidecar. Reviewer context: this fragment covers enabling zstd compression for outbound telemetry from the Brackwell ingest nodes. The sidecar batches payloads, compresses at level 6, and forwards to the collector. Compression ratios are logged per batch under telempress.compress.ratio. The sidecar also signs each batch before forwarding, so edit /etc/telempress/sidecar.env and place the signing secret on the line that follows.

env line for yahip-tafog: RELAY_SECRET3=4ca

#
# Plugin authors calling resolve_rate() should be aware that results are
# memoized per jurisdiction code. The cache is refreshed on a fixed
# interval rather than on demand, so stale rates can persist briefly
# after the Quillmark rate feed publishes an update. Entries are evicted
# by least-recent use once the table reaches capacity; oversized
# jurisdictions are never pinned. Do not mutate these values at runtime;
# override them via plugin config instead. The defaults below were
# chosen from production traces on the Harrowgate cluster.

constants for bawif-kawif:
QUOTAS = {
    "ulaael": 5,
    "holael": 10,
}

This summary covers the approved headcount framework for next year across all Dunmarsh Retail branches. Total approved growth is 4.2 percent, weighted toward the Kestrel Valley and Morrowfield locations where the Ashgrove product rollout continues. Backfill approvals will require regional sign-off from Q2 onward. Branch managers should reconcile current rosters against the allocation sheets distributed last week and flag variances promptly. The confidential note below sets out the underlying business plan.

internal memo for fajog-yagaf: Gross margin on Ulaael came in at 20 percent against a plan of 10 percent. Only 9 of the 80 pilot accounts renewed Ulaael, so a churn review is set for July 1.